Role Title: Semiconductor Devices & Microelectronics Expert


Role Type: Contractor


Location: Remote


micro1 is engaging Semiconductor Devices & Microelectronics Experts to contribute to a dynamic customer project focused on advancing semiconductor technologies and microelectronics solutions. In this role, you'll apply your expertise to help train next-generation AI systems. Your work will shape how models learn, reason, and perform through high-quality, real-world input. No prior experience in AI is required — your domain knowledge is what matters.


Scope of Work

  1. Analyze and provide insights on semiconductor device physics, operational principles, and recent advances.
  2. Evaluate and discuss microfabrication techniques, including process integration and yield optimization.
  3. Contribute technical assessments on device scaling, performance modeling, and reliability methodologies.
  4. Review and critique materials used in electronic and semiconducting device fabrication.
  5. Create detailed written explanations and verbal clarifications of complex engineering concepts for AI model training purposes.
  6. Deliver structured feedback on project data to ensure technical accuracy and completeness.
  7. Collaborate asynchronously with project coordinators and other domain experts within the platform.


Preferred Qualifications

  1. Advanced degree (Master’s or PhD) in Electrical Engineering, Materials Science, Physics, or a related discipline.
  2. Extensive experience in semiconductor device design, fabrication processes, and microelectronics engineering.
  3. Proven understanding of semiconductor physics, device modeling, and reliability testing.
  4. Hands-on exposure to modern microfabrication and process integration techniques.
  5. Strong analytical and critical thinking skills with the ability to break down complex topics.
  6. Exceptional written and verbal communication skills, with a focus on articulating technical concepts clearly.
  7. Prior experience contributing to technical publications, patents, or collaborative R&D projects is a plus.


Compensation Structure

Compensation is output-based; experts are paid per task that meets the project specifications. The time required to complete work may vary depending on the expert’s experience and workflow. Minimum submission requirements apply. Experts must submit a minimum of tasks per week.


Start Timeline & Availability

We typically fill roles within 48 hours and are looking for experts ready to jump in right away. If selected, we expect you to start your first tasks within 24–48 hours of completing onboarding.
